Woodard recuses office from Juan Luna case

GAINESVILLE - Hall County State Court Solicitor Stephanie Woodard has recused her office from the case of downtown Gainesville restaurant owner Juan Luna.

Luna, the owner of Luna's, faces charges growing out of an on-the-street confrontation with another downtown restaurant owner, Scott Dixon, owner of Scott's on the Square.

Woodard said Wednesday she removed her office from the case "due to community relationships with both the victim and the defendant" and says the case has been referred to the state Attorney General's office for appointment of a special prosecutor.

Luna was scheduled to be arraigned Wednesday on charges of simple assault and pointing a gun at another. That proceeding was postponed after Woodard stepped aside as prosecutor, and is pending appointment of the special prosecutor.
